    Plasma state identification in the COMPASS tokamak.

    The dataset contains selected diagnostic measurements from the COMPASS tokamak and manually created labels of plasma state in the form of csv files. The dataset defines 4 plasma states: L-mode, H-mode, ELM leading edge and ELM trailing edge. The data is intended to be used for training and testing deep neural networks in the task of plasma state identification. The dataset is divided into two parts, supervised (labeled) and unsupervised (unlabeled), each containing 20 COMPASS discharges. Within the unsupervised dataset there are 11 labeled discharges that can be used as a test set.
